Monte Carasso, a region in the canton of Ticino, Switzerland, presents a varied landscape ideal for outdoor activities. Its terrain encompasses hilly areas, scenic valleys, and extensive chestnut woods, with elevations providing diverse challenges and panoramic views. This natural setting makes Monte Carasso a suitable destination for several sports like road cycling, hiking, touring cycling, mountain biking, and more. The region is defined by its elevated hamlets and offers vistas of Lake Maggiore and the surrounding mountains.

What are the main attractions in Monte Carasso?

Key attractions include the Carasc Tibetan Bridge, a 886-foot (270-meter) suspension bridge, and Mornera, a panoramic terrace accessible by cable car. The area also features the historic Church of San Bernard in Curzútt and extensive chestnut woods. Views of Lake Maggiore and the Bellinzona castles are common along many routes.

How can I access Mornera from Monte Carasso?

Mornera is accessible by a modern cable car directly from Monte Carasso. This cable car transports visitors to a panoramic terrace at 4,593 feet (1,400 meters). From Mornera, visitors can enjoy views over Bellinzona, the Magadino plain, and the main peaks of the Alps.

What is the Carasc Tibetan Bridge?

The Carasc Tibetan Bridge is a significant highlight in Monte Carasso, known as one of Switzerland's longest suspension bridges. It spans 886 feet (270 meters) at a height of 426 feet (130 meters). The bridge connects Monte Carasso with Sementina and is typically reached via a roughly 45-minute hike from Curzútt.

What natural features can be seen in Monte Carasso?

Monte Carasso is characterized by its elevated hamlets, extensive chestnut woods, and views of Lake Maggiore. The Verzasca River, known for its wild nature and unique rock formations, is nearby. Mornera offers panoramic views of Bellinzona and the Alps, along with two small lakes.
